Hi All

Just walked in .What a great day for a drive. First of all Simba AKA ? is the most gentle loving dog I have every meet and I dont mean for a Chow Chow I mean of any dog .Unreal

Ok lets start with thanking Bama for making the internet connection with her fur baby
The kennel Cuyahoga County Kennel could not have been more profesional Very clean and new. But most important they dont open until noon but they had a staff member be available at 10 am so I could get a early start and the paper work was done when I got there.
Ok poor nameless one aka Simba came out with a huge clear shield on so he would not chew his stitches, well first he ran head on into the glass front door, then he could not see the curb on the way to the grass to pee Ok so off with this . Then I got him into the car with a bowl of water. Within 10 minutes it was all lick hands lick face as he jumped to the front seat, So the next 3 hours was me massaging him and him making squealing and grunting and snorting sounds every time Istopped. Oh yeh plus 3 brushings while we were on the road. Now I have a fur car.
Meet Mark and made the transfer.

I am so happy that Simaba has meet the right people for his personality as Mark and his wife are gems.


Well the rest of the story is up to Bama.

Hey Bama, you gotta be careful with a name like that. There is an old story by the Cajun humorist Justin Wilson that goes:

Two guys came to south Louisana to hunt birds, but needed to rent a bird dog. The only one the outfitter had available was "Old Sarge" at $150 a day. Well, they thought that was pretty expensive, but decided to pay it rather than not being able to hunt at all.

By the end of the day, they had had the best day of bird hunting in their whole life. Sarge knew every bird in the county by their first name, and just where they would be at any given time. He was the most fantastic bird dog they had ever seen.

The next year, they came back, and wouldn't have any dog other than "Old Sarge". He was now renting at $200 a day. They paid it without a second thought, and had another perfect day.

For the next year, all they could talk about was going bird hunting with "Old Sarge" again. When they finally got back to the outfitter's place, they told him, "we want Old Sarge, and we don't care what he costs. He's the best bird dog in the world!"

The outfitter said, "Well, that'll be ten bucks"
The guys said, "No, you don't understand. We gotta have Old Sarge, the dog you charged us $200 a day for last year. He was worth every cent of it. We want Old Sarge!"

The outfitter said, "Well, Old Sarge ain't what he used to be. Some city fellers called him, "Colonel". Now all we can get him to do is sit on his butt and bark!" :lol:
